Ella Kesaeva: no more grounds to postpone the trial on "Voice of Beslan"

Ella Kesaeva, co-chair of the "Voice of Beslan" Organization, has stated that all the necessary documents have been submitted to the Court of Nazran (Ingushetia) for restart of the trial on charges of extremism.

Today, the Court of the city of Nazran (Ingushetia) has postponed its first session on the case about the materials of the "Voice of Beslan" Organization, published in its website, until Tuesday, January 15, because the court has not received the petitions on holding an independent expert's examination of the text.

"Yesterday we sent two petitions by express mail and a telegram, but the court received nothing; therefore, today we've sent a petition asking to hold an examination by fax. In order to avoid any misunderstanding, that nothing has arrived again, we called back the Nazran Court and made sure that they've received our fax message. Now they have no grounds to postpone the session. Once they've accepted the case, let them consider it, but without our participation," co-chair of the Committee Ella Kesaeva said in her interview to the "Caucasian Knot" correspondent.

Meanwhile, the "Voice of Beslan" has received no answer to the complaint against the actions of M. Kh. Aushev, Acting Public Prosecutor of Ingushetia, from Deputy General Public Prosecutor for the SFD Ivan Sydoruk; therefore, the members of the organization have decided to call him up tomorrow.

The "Caucasian Knot" has informed earlier that the members of the NGO "Voice of Beslan" have decided not to go to the trial to Nazran (Ingushetia) on the case of recognizing the information materials of their organization to be extremist ones.

The members of the Committee find the statement of the Acting Public Prosecutor of Ingushetia to be illegal, and on January 13 sent a telegram to the Nazran Court stating that they would not take part in the trial without holding an independent expert's examination of the statement.

Zelimkhan Khangoshvili. Photo courtesy of press service of HRC 'Memorial', http://memohrc.org/ Zelimkhan Khangoshvili

A participant of the second Chechen military campaign, one of the field commanders close to Shamil Basaev and Aslan Maskhadov. Shot dead in Berlin in 2019.

Magomed Daudov. Photo: screenshot of the video http://video.agaclip.com/w=atDtPvLYH9o Magomed Daudov

Magomed "Lord" Daudov is a former Chechen militant who was awarded the title of "Hero of Russia", the chairman of the Chechen parliament under Ramzan Kadyrov.

Tumso Abdurakhmanov. Screenshot from video posted by Abu-Saddam Shishani [LIVE] http://www.youtube.com/watch?v=mIR3s7AB0Uw Tumso Abdurakhmanov

Tumso Abdurakhmanov is a blogger from Chechnya. After a conflict with Ramzan Kadyrov's relative, he left the republic and went first to Georgia, and then to Poland, where he is trying to get political asylum.
